CS8492-DBMS Syllabus
CS8492-DBMS Syllabus
CS8492-DBMS Syllabus
net
et
To understand the fundamental concepts of transaction processing- concurrency
control techniques and recovery procedures.
To have an introductory knowledge about the Storage and Query processing
Techniques
.n
UNIT I RELATIONAL DATABASES 10
Purpose of Database System – Views of data – Data Models – Database System Architecture –
Introduction to relational databases – Relational Model – Keys – Relational Algebra – SQL
pz
fundamentals – Advanced SQL features – Embedded SQL– Dynamic SQL
Recovery - Save Points – Isolation Levels – SQL Facilities for Concurrency and Recovery.
OQL - XML Databases: XML Hierarchical Model, DTD, XML Schema, XQuery – Information
Retrieval: IR Concepts, Retrieval Models, Queries in IR systems.
w
TOTAL: 45 PERIODS
OUTCOMES:
Upon completion of the course, the students will be able to:
w
Classify the modern and futuristic database applications based on size and complexity
Map ER model to Relational model to perform database design effectively
Write queries using normalization criteria and optimize queries
Compare and contrast various indexing strategies in different database systems
Appraise how advanced databases differ from traditional databases.
www.padeepz.net
www.padeepz.net
TEXT BOOKS:
1. Abraham Silberschatz, Henry F. Korth, S. Sudharshan, ―Database System Concepts‖, Sixth
Edition, Tata McGraw Hill, 2011.
2. Ramez Elmasri, Shamkant B. Navathe, ―Fundamentals of Database Systems‖, Sixth Edition,
Pearson Education, 2011.
REFERENCES:
1. C.J.Date, A.Kannan, S.Swamynathan, ―An Introduction to Database Systems‖, Eighth Edition,
et
Pearson Education, 2006.
2. Raghu Ramakrishnan, ―Database Management Systems‖, Fourth Edition, McGraw-Hill
College Publications, 2015.
3. G.K.Gupta,"Database Management Systems‖, Tata McGraw Hill, 2011.
.n
pz
ee
ad
.p
w
w
w
www.padeepz.net